If your wireless router is not near your console, you may get a better wireless signal by using a wireless networking adaptor. When you connect an Xbox 360 Wireless Networking Adaptor to an Xbox 360 E console, the console automatically uses the wireless adaptor instead of the built-in WiFi. When you set your Xbox 360 to a static IP address, the router does not know that the Xbox 360 is using that IP address. So the very same IP address may be handed to another computer or console later, and that will prevent both devices from connecting to the internet.

One of the most exciting features of the R9000 is the integration and futureproofing for next-gen Wireless-AD. What separates Wireless-AD from most WiFi connections today is its capability for 7Gbps – 4 Gbps higher than the max speeds of Wireless-AC in optimal conditions via WiFi.
